Echinospio [Echinospio]
Description
The genus Echinospio consists of polychaete worms within the Ampharetidae family, characterized by their spiny appearance due to bristles along their bodies. Echinospio species are tube builders, creating protective structures in sandy or muddy marine substrates. They play a role in the benthic ecosystem, contributing to the sediment structure and nutrient cycling.
